The combined offering of the two companies includes world-class expertise in driveline testing, from powertrain to batteries, and NVH test services, from full vehicle to component level.
CRITT M2A provides services to customers in Europe and Asia including turbocharger, engine, NVH and battery cell testing.
The company has a number of international partners and takes part in European research projects with research institutions, industrial clusters and renowned academics. It has just celebrated its 10th anniversary as a private company.
Millbrook Group has a wide, international customer base served primarily from its three sites in the UK and Finland.
